WebMay 19, 2024 · If you’re looking to store your chocolate-covered pretzels for longer than two weeks, it’s important to refrigerate them. This will keep the chocolate firm and fresh tasting. To do this, simply wrap the pretzels tightly in plastic wrap or aluminum foil and then place them into an airtight container. Place in the fridge and they’ll be good ... WebFeb 23, 2016 · 5 Answers. I store mine in the freezer. It keeps it hard and thaws without an issue. Fridge or freezer are both good places to keep your chocolate so it doesn't get melty. If those aren't an option for some reason, then try finding a cool, dark place that won't get too much hotter during the day. A couple ideas:

WebDec 28, 2013 · There's nothing you can add to prevent chocolate from melting. Either, like stated before, your shell is too thin, or the temper is off. I do a lot of chocolate molding, and I don't have any trouble with melting. If the shell is too thin, the fondant is probably leaking through and causing the breakdown.
